El Presidente Posted May 30, 2017 Posted May 30, 2017 Hard to believe we are nearly into June! Had some memorable cigars during May.... some dogs as well. Let's fo the highlights first: 1. Vegas Robaina Don Alejandro. ....have been hoofing into these since the vid review with Ken. They have all been from the same box. I never want this box to end. 2. Por larranaga Belicoso Extra. ....it took a long time but they have turned the corner into caramel sticks. As good as the PL Robusto AP Regional? probably not but not far off it. If you have some close by, give them a run in June. 3. Cohiba Robusto 2008. ....Class is a word I try not to throw around too much. This cigar has it in spades. Intensity and diversity of flavours is astounding. 4. Cohiba Lancero 2010. .....I broke the box to share with Stan as he was getting away for the "skinny" community. Citrus, coffee, cake, honey. Put them all together and there is little more you need. The Hounds. 1. HDM Epi 2. (2016) ....they have managed to screw up so many of these (in 25's) over the past 6 months. I normally love a HDM Epi 2. From construction issues to poor wrappers and either tunnelling or exploding. They need to get back to basics. 2. R&J Wide Churchills ....a star for such a long time until the May batch arrived. The worst cigars of the year to date. Not only did they use the worst of wrappers but they forgot the filler. The 2017 Queensland Reds Rugby team of cigars. Soulless, going nowhere and never will.
